Cheam to Castleford by train

A train trip from Cheam to Castleford takes about 4hrs 46 mins on average, covering roughly 170 miles (274 kilometres). With around 32 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£34.20,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

What are my cheap ticket options for Cheam to Castleford journeys?

From booking in Advance, to our FairSplits, here are our tips for you to find the best price

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Cheam to Castleford start from as little as £34.20

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Cheam to Castleford start from £75.00 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Cheam to Castleford are available for £174.50 one way

Station Facilities

Cheam Station features a ticket office with extensive opening hours from Monday through Sunday, complemented by ticket machines for a hassle-free buying and collection process. Conveniently, these machines support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, offering accessibility for varied needs. The station ensures enhanced commuter experience with available refreshment facilities - though it lacks an ATM or shops.

Customer support is a priority at Cheam, with helpful staff available from early morning until after midnight on all days. For travelers needing assistance, customer help points are strategically situated on platforms, ensuring service accessibility any time of the day. Unfortunately, the station lacks luggage storage services and has no waiting rooms, but there are seating areas on the platform for passengers to use while waiting for their trains.

Accessibility and Support

The inclusive ethos extends to accessibility, with step-free access to both platforms, although transferring between platforms without steps isn't available. An assistance meeting point on Platform 2 and the availability of a ramp for train access further enhance the station's accessibility. However, do note that there are no accessible toilets on site.

Parking your vehicle is straightforward with 119 spaces available, including 3 accessible spaces. The station also offers bicycle storage facilities, though they aren't sheltered, and no bicycle hire facilities are currently available on-site. For those who drive, there's the convenience of free parking operated by APCOA Parking UK, ensuring that your journey begins seamlessly.

Facilities and Amenities

While Castleford Station may lack some of the more comprehensive facilities of larger stations, it is equipped to meet essential travel needs. Though there's no staffed ticket office, all travelers can conveniently collect their tickets from accessible ticket machines available at the station. Smartcard holders will find validators on-site to streamline their journey.

Accessibility is a strong point of Castleford, as step-free access is available throughout the station ensuring ease for passengers with mobility concerns. The station has also been equipped with lifts between platforms, allowing for more comfortable travel across the station’s premises. For those with hearing difficulties, an induction loop is available, and assistance at the station can be coordinated via the help points or the conductor on your train.

Onward Travel Options

When visiting Castleford, you're not limited to rail. Those requiring alternate transport options can rest easy knowing that bus services and taxis are within reach. A bus stop is located conveniently close to the station, making it an easy choice for local travels. For those preferring cabs, taxi services can be explored through Cab4You, ensuring a seamless transition from train to vehicle.

For the environmentally conscious or fitness enthusiasts, bicycle storage is available within the car park, although bicycle hire is not offered on-site.
